I installed open-vm-tools on my ~amd64 running under VMWare vSphere 4.1, per the very helpful guide.
Code: | * Messages for package app-emulation/open-vm-tools-kmod-0.0.20110223.368700-r1:
* vmxnet3 for Linux is now upstream (as of Linux 2.6.32)
* pvscsi for Linux is now upstream (vmw_pvscsi) (as of Linux 2.6.33)
* vmmemctl for Linux is now upstream (vmw_balloon) (as of Linux 2.6.34) |
I am compiling in all of the above modules to 2.6.38. Given the file list below, should/can I remove open-vm-tools-kmod, so vmxnet.ko will not conflict with the kernel 2.6.38 compiled-in version? Or is vmxnet.ko not the same as vmxnet3?
Code: | # equery files open-vm-tools-kmod
* Searching for open-vm-tools-kmod ...
* Contents of app-emulation/open-vm-tools-kmod-0.0.20110223.368700-r1:
/etc
/etc/udev
/etc/udev/rules.d
/etc/udev/rules.d/60-vmware.rules
/lib
/lib/modules
/lib/modules/2.6.38-gentoo-r1
/lib/modules/2.6.38-gentoo-r1/net
/lib/modules/2.6.38-gentoo-r1/net/vmxnet.ko
/lib/modules/2.6.38-gentoo-r1/openvmtools
/lib/modules/2.6.38-gentoo-r1/openvmtools/vmblock.ko
/lib/modules/2.6.38-gentoo-r1/openvmtools/vmci.ko
/lib/modules/2.6.38-gentoo-r1/openvmtools/vmhgfs.ko
/lib/modules/2.6.38-gentoo-r1/openvmtools/vmsync.ko
/lib/modules/2.6.38-gentoo-r1/openvmtools/vsock.ko |
